We have developed a novel autocorrelator composed of only reflective elements, which have functions as a beam splitter and an optical delay line for fringe-resolved autocorrelation. The measurement of femtosecond laser pulse is demonstrated in the visible region.
An all-reflective interferometric autocorrelator
